Creating Spectacular Designs for Magazine Covers and Features
When working with Handles, the first thing you notice is its inherent ability to command attention without shouting. In the world of editorial design, the cover is your handshake with the reader; it must be inviting yet distinct. Because Handles is a beautiful display font perfect for magazines and crafts, it shines brightest when used for mastheads, issue titles, and feature headlines. I recently tested this by redesigning a digital magazine cover focused on slow living. The clean lines and unique character shapes of the font allowed the title to sit comfortably over complex imagery without losing legibility. Unlike many decorative options that sacrifice readability for style, this display typeface maintains clarity even at large sizes, ensuring that your key messages are absorbed instantly by scrolling audiences on mobile devices or browsing readers in print.
Using Handles for interior feature pages also adds a layer of sophistication. When paired with a neutral sans serif for body copy, the contrast creates a visual hierarchy that guides the eye naturally through the article. It acts as an anchor, giving weight to important sections while allowing the supporting text to breathe.
